زندگی تانریکولو
اپنے طرز زندگی پر ایک تازہ نظر ڈالیں۔

3d گیم بنانے کا پروگرام مفت

اس مضمون میں، ہم مفت 3D گیم بنانے کے پروگراموں کے بارے میں معلومات دیں گے۔ ایک 3D گیم ایک ویڈیو گیم ہے جو سہ جہتی گرافکس کا استعمال کرتا ہے۔ اس کا مطلب ہے کہ یہ گیم کے کرداروں، اشیاء اور ماحول کو تین جہتوں میں دکھاتا ہے۔ 3D گیمز 2D گیمز سے زیادہ حقیقت پسندانہ اور عمیق تجربہ پیش کر سکتے ہیں۔


3D گیمز کمپیوٹر، کنسولز اور موبائل آلات کے لیے تیار کیے جا سکتے ہیں۔ کمپیوٹر 3D گیمز کے لیے سب سے عام پلیٹ فارم ہیں۔ کنسولز 3D گیمنگ کے لیے بھی ایک اچھا انتخاب ہیں کیونکہ ان میں عام طور پر طاقتور گرافکس پروسیسنگ یونٹ ہوتے ہیں۔ حالیہ برسوں میں موبائل آلات 3D گیمز کے لیے تیزی سے مقبول ہوئے ہیں۔

3D گیمز مختلف قسم کے ہو سکتے ہیں۔ اسے 3D گیمز بنانے کے لیے استعمال کیا جا سکتا ہے، بشمول پلیٹ فارم گیمز، پزل گیمز، رول پلےنگ گیمز، ایکشن گیمز، اسٹریٹجی گیمز اور اسپورٹس گیمز۔

3D گیمز بنانے کے لیے مختلف گیم انجن استعمال کیے جاتے ہیں۔ گیم انجن وہ سافٹ ویئر ہیں جو گیم ڈویلپرز کو اپنے گیمز بنانے میں مدد کرتے ہیں۔ یونٹی، غیر حقیقی انجن اور گوڈٹ انجن 3D گیمز بنانے کے لیے کچھ مشہور گیم انجن ہیں۔

3D گیم ڈویلپمنٹ ایک ایسا عمل ہے جو کمپیوٹر گیمز بنانے کے لیے استعمال ہوتا ہے۔ 3D گیمز وہ گیمز ہیں جو اپنے گرافکس اور گیم پلے سے توجہ مبذول کرواتے ہیں۔ 3D گیمز تیار کرنے کے لیے مختلف ٹولز اور سافٹ ویئر استعمال کیے جا سکتے ہیں۔

مفت 3D گیم بنانے کے پروگرام، یہ ابتدائی اور تجربہ کار ڈویلپرز کے لیے متعدد اختیارات پیش کرتا ہے۔ ان پروگراموں کو عام طور پر کوڈنگ کے علم کی ضرورت نہیں ہوتی ہے اور یہ سیکھنے میں آسان ہیں۔

مفت 3D گیم بنانے کے پروگراموں میں شامل ہیں:

  • Godot انجن: Godot Engine ایک مفت اور اوپن سورس گیم انجن ہے جو 2D اور 3D گیمز بنانے کے لیے استعمال ہوتا ہے۔ Godot Engine مہارت اور تجربہ کی مختلف سطحوں والے ڈویلپرز کے لیے موزوں ہے۔
  • بلینڈر: بلینڈر مفت اور اوپن سورس سافٹ ویئر ہے جو 3D ماڈلنگ، اینیمیشن اور گیم ڈیولپمنٹ کے لیے استعمال ہوتا ہے۔ بلینڈر ٹولز کا ایک طاقتور سیٹ پیش کرتا ہے جسے 3D گیمز تیار کرنے کے لیے استعمال کیا جا سکتا ہے۔
  • اتحاد یونٹی ایک گیم انجن ہے جو 2D اور 3D گیمز بنانے کے لیے استعمال ہوتا ہے۔ یونیٹی مہارت اور تجربے کی مختلف سطحوں والے ڈویلپرز کے لیے موزوں ہے۔ تاہم، یونٹی کے مفت ورژن میں کچھ خصوصیات کا فقدان ہے۔

آپ ان میں سے کسی بھی پروگرام کا استعمال کرتے ہوئے 3D گیمز بنا سکتے ہیں۔ تاہم، یہ ضروری ہے کہ پروگراموں کی خصوصیات اور صلاحیتوں کا موازنہ کیا جائے اور اس کا انتخاب کریں جو آپ کے لیے بہترین ہو۔

ان میں سے ہر ایک پروگرام کے بارے میں مزید معلومات یہاں ہیں:

Godot Engine: مفت 3D گیم بنانے کا پروگرام

گوڈٹ انجن نے 2014 میں جوآن لینیٹسکی اور ایریل منظور کے ذریعہ ترقی شروع کی تھی، اور اس کا پہلا مستحکم ورژن 2017 میں جاری کیا گیا تھا۔ Godot Engine مفت اور اوپن سورس ہونے کی وجہ سے نمایاں ہے۔ اس کا مطلب ہے کہ آپ کو Godot انجن استعمال کرنے کے لیے کوئی فیس ادا کرنے یا لائسنس خریدنے کی ضرورت نہیں ہے۔ آپ Godot Engine کے سورس کوڈ تک بھی رسائی حاصل کر سکتے ہیں اور اپنی تبدیلیاں خود کر سکتے ہیں۔


Godot انجن کو 2D اور 3D گیمز بنانے کے لیے استعمال کیا جا سکتا ہے۔ Godot Engine مہارت اور تجربہ کی مختلف سطحوں والے ڈویلپرز کے لیے موزوں ہے۔ ابتدائیوں کے لیے، Godot Engine کی بنیادی باتیں سیکھنے کے لیے بہت سے آن لائن کورسز اور ٹیوٹوریلز دستیاب ہیں۔ مزید تجربہ کار ڈویلپرز کے لیے، Godot Engine جدید خصوصیات اور لچک پیش کرتا ہے۔

Godot انجن کی کچھ خصوصیات یہ ہیں:

  • 2D اور 3D گیم ڈویلپمنٹ سپورٹ: Godot Engine کو 2D اور 3D گیمز بنانے کے لیے استعمال کیا جا سکتا ہے۔
  • کراس پلیٹ فارم کی تقسیم: Godot Engine آپ کو Android، iOS، Windows، macOS، Linux اور دیگر پلیٹ فارمز کے لیے گیمز تقسیم کرنے کی اجازت دیتا ہے۔
  • جامع ٹول سیٹ: Godot Engine میں وہ تمام ٹولز اور خصوصیات شامل ہیں جن کی آپ کو گیمز تیار کرنے کے لیے درکار ہیں۔
  • انکوڈنگ سپورٹ: Godot Engine مختلف پروگرامنگ زبانوں کو سپورٹ کرتا ہے جیسے GDScript، C# اور C++۔

بلینڈر: 3D گیم بنانے کا پروگرام

بلینڈر کو بلینڈر فاؤنڈیشن نے 2002 میں تیار کرنا شروع کیا۔ بلینڈر مفت اور اوپن سورس سافٹ ویئر ہے جو 3D ماڈلنگ، اینیمیشن اور گیم ڈیولپمنٹ کے لیے استعمال ہوتا ہے۔ بلینڈر ٹولز کا ایک طاقتور سیٹ پیش کرتا ہے جسے 3D گیمز تیار کرنے کے لیے استعمال کیا جا سکتا ہے۔

بلینڈر مہارت اور تجربہ کی مختلف سطحوں والے ڈویلپرز کے لیے موزوں ہے۔ ابتدائیوں کے لیے، بلینڈر کی بنیادی باتیں سیکھنے کے لیے بہت سے آن لائن کورسز اور ٹیوٹوریلز دستیاب ہیں۔ مزید تجربہ کار ڈویلپرز کے لیے، Blender جدید خصوصیات اور لچک پیش کرتا ہے۔

بلینڈر کی کچھ خصوصیات یہ ہیں:

  • 3D ماڈلنگ: بلینڈر 3D ماڈل بنانے، ترمیم کرنے اور متحرک کرنے کے لیے طاقتور ٹولز پیش کرتا ہے۔
  • 3D حرکت پذیری: بلینڈر 3D اینیمیشن بنانے کے لیے طاقتور ٹولز پیش کرتا ہے۔
  • کھیل کی ترقی: بلینڈر متعدد خصوصیات اور ٹولز پیش کرتا ہے جو 3D گیمز بنانے کے لیے استعمال کیے جا سکتے ہیں۔

اتحاد : 3D گیم ماڈلنگ اور گیم بنانے والا انجن

یونٹی کو یونٹی ٹیکنالوجیز نے 2005 میں تیار کرنا شروع کیا۔ یونٹی ایک گیم انجن ہے جو 2D اور 3D گیمز بنانے کے لیے استعمال ہوتا ہے۔ یونیٹی مہارت اور تجربے کی مختلف سطحوں والے ڈویلپرز کے لیے موزوں ہے۔

اتحاد کے دو ورژن ہیں: مفت اور معاوضہ۔ مفت ورژن یونٹی کی بنیادی خصوصیات پیش کرتا ہے۔ تاہم، اس میں کچھ خصوصیات کا فقدان ہے۔ ادا شدہ ورژن مزید جدید خصوصیات اور لچک پیش کرتا ہے۔


اتحاد کی کچھ خصوصیات یہ ہیں:

  • 2D اور 3D گیم ڈویلپمنٹ سپورٹ: اتحاد کو 2D اور 3D گیمز بنانے کے لیے استعمال کیا جا سکتا ہے۔
  • کراس پلیٹ فارم کی تقسیم: یونٹی آپ کو اینڈرائیڈ، آئی او ایس، ونڈوز، میک او ایس، لینکس اور دیگر پلیٹ فارمز کے لیے گیمز تقسیم کرنے کی اجازت دیتا ہے۔
  • جامع ٹول سیٹ: اتحاد میں وہ تمام ٹولز اور خصوصیات شامل ہیں جن کی آپ کو گیمز تیار کرنے کے لیے درکار ہیں۔
  • انکوڈنگ سپورٹ: مختلف پروگرامنگ زبانوں کو سپورٹ کرتا ہے جیسے یونٹی، سی #، جاوا اسکرپٹ اور بو

مفت 3D گیم بنانے کے پروگراموں کا انتخاب کرتے وقت غور کرنے کے لیے یہاں کچھ عوامل ہیں:

  • تجربہ: اگر آپ کو کوڈنگ کا علم ہے، تو آپ زیادہ طاقتور اور لچکدار گیم انجن کا انتخاب کر سکتے ہیں۔ اگر آپ کو کوڈنگ کا علم نہیں ہے، تو آپ ایک گیم انجن منتخب کر سکتے ہیں جو سیکھنا آسان ہو۔
  • گیم کی قسم: اس بارے میں سوچیں کہ آپ کس قسم کے کھیل بنانا چاہتے ہیں۔ ایک مخصوص قسم کے گیم کے لیے ڈیزائن کردہ گیم انجن کا انتخاب آپ کے گیم کو بنانا آسان بنا سکتا ہے۔
  • زیلکیلر: غور کریں کہ آپ کو کن خصوصیات کی ضرورت ہے۔ اگر آپ اپنے گیم میں پیچیدہ گیم میکینکس شامل کرنا چاہتے ہیں تو آپ کو ایک طاقتور گیم انجن کا انتخاب کرنا ہوگا۔

مفت 3D گیم بنانے والے پروگرام ابتدائی اور تجربہ کار ڈویلپرز کے لیے متعدد اختیارات پیش کرتے ہیں۔ یہ پروگرام 3D گیم ڈویلپمنٹ سیکھنے اور اپنی گیمز بنانے کا بہترین طریقہ ہیں۔

تھری ڈی گیم کیسے بنایا جائے؟ کھیل بنانے کے مراحل

3D گیمز بنانا ایک پیچیدہ عمل ہوسکتا ہے، لیکن بنیادی اقدامات پر عمل کرکے آپ 3D گیمز تیار کرنا شروع کر سکتے ہیں۔ 3D گیم بنانے کا عمل شروع کرنے میں آپ کی مدد کرنے کے لیے یہ بنیادی اقدامات ہیں:

  1. گیم آئیڈیا اور ڈیزائن:
    • پہلا قدم آپ کے گیم کا تصور اور ڈیزائن بنانے کے ساتھ شروع ہوتا ہے۔ اپنے گیم کے اہم عناصر کا تعین کریں، جیسے کہ کہانی، گیم میکینکس، کردار، اور عالمی ڈیزائن۔
  2. گیم انجن کا انتخاب:
    • گیم انجن آپ کو اپنے گیم کا بنیادی ڈھانچہ بنانے میں مدد کرتا ہے۔ یونیٹی، غیر حقیقی انجن، گوڈوٹ جیسے مشہور گیم انجنوں میں سے انتخاب کریں۔ آپ کا انتخاب آپ کے گیم کی ضروریات اور پلیٹ فارمز پر منحصر ہونا چاہیے۔
  3. 3D ماڈلنگ اور اینیمیشن:
    • آپ کو اپنے گیم کے کرداروں، اشیاء اور دنیا کے لیے 3D ماڈل بنانے کی ضرورت ہوگی۔ 3D ماڈلنگ سافٹ ویئر مفت اختیارات جیسے بلینڈر سے لے کر مایا یا 3ds میکس جیسے پیشہ ورانہ سافٹ ویئر تک ہے۔ آپ کو اپنے کرداروں اور اشیاء میں متحرک تصاویر شامل کرنے کے لیے اینیمیشن سافٹ ویئر استعمال کرنے کی بھی ضرورت پڑ سکتی ہے۔
  4. پروگرامنگ اور اسکرپٹ:
    • کوڈنگ یا بصری اسکرپٹنگ ٹولز کے ساتھ اپنے گیم کی منطق اور گیم پلے بنائیں۔ پروگرام کے کردار کے رویے، دشمن کی AI، فزکس، اور آپ کے گیم انجن (مثال کے طور پر، C#، C++، یا GDScript) سے تعاون یافتہ پروگرامنگ زبانوں کا استعمال کرتے ہوئے دیگر گیم میکینکس۔
  5. بصری اثرات اور صوتی ڈیزائن:
    • بصری اثرات (مثلاً دھماکے کے اثرات، آگ، پانی) اور ساؤنڈ ڈیزائن (موسیقی، صوتی اثرات) آپ کے گیم کو مزید دلکش بناتے ہیں۔ ان عناصر کو شامل کرنے اور ایڈجسٹ کرنے کے لیے مناسب سافٹ ویئر استعمال کریں۔
  6. گیم ٹیسٹنگ اور ڈیبگنگ:
    • باقاعدگی سے اپنے گیم کی جانچ اور ڈیبگ کریں۔ درون گیم کیڑے ٹھیک کریں، بیلنس کے مسائل کو ٹھیک کریں اور صارف کے تاثرات کو مدنظر رکھیں۔
  7. اصلاح اور کارکردگی میں بہتری:
    • آسانی سے چلانے کے لیے اپنے گیم کو بہتر بنائیں۔ یہ گرافکس، طبیعیات کے حسابات اور دیگر خصوصیات کی کارکردگی کو بہتر بناتا ہے، جس سے آپ کا گیم پلے ہموار ہوتا ہے۔
  8. تقسیم:
    • اپنے گیم کو اپنے ٹارگٹڈ پلیٹ فارمز (PC، کنسول، موبائل آلات) پر تقسیم کریں۔ ہر پلیٹ فارم کی اپنی ضروریات ہوتی ہیں، لہذا مطابقت اور سرٹیفیکیشن کی ضروریات پر غور کریں۔
  9. مارکیٹنگ اور اشاعت:
    • اپنے کھیل کو فروغ دینے کے لیے مارکیٹنگ کی حکمت عملی بنائیں۔ اپنے گیم کو App Store، Google Play، Steam یا دیگر پلیٹ فارمز پر شائع کرنے کے لیے اقدامات پر عمل کریں۔
  10. تاثرات اور اپ ڈیٹس:
    • اپنے گیم کے ریلیز ہونے کے بعد کھلاڑیوں کے تاثرات کو مدنظر رکھتے ہوئے ضروری اپ ڈیٹ کریں۔ اپنے گیم کو مسلسل بہتر بنائیں اور نیا مواد شامل کریں۔
INTERNATIONAL
آپ کو بھی یہ پسند آسکتے ہیں۔
تبصرہ